“Consultants in general medicine, ophthalmology, ENT and care participated in the voluntary service,” said the society’s Secretary-General Dr. Ali Al-Fakieh, a consultant of family and social medicine at King Abdul Aziz University Hospital.

The beneficiaries were treated for a range of medical conditions, including diabetes, high blood pressure and diseases of the abdomen, chest, eye, teeth, nose, ear and throat.

“Medical caravans with volunteers will be operating year-round to extend free medical assistance to the poor in Makkah province,” said Fakieh.

It also undertakes awareness activities about health issues.
